Working late nights ignited a love in me for Old Time Radio (OTR) shows. Classics such as Dragnet, Tales of the Texas Rangers, I was a Communist for the FBI, Fibber McGee and Molly, the Jack Benny Show and countless others. It's like a time machine that lets you glimpse into the past of our culture.
